掌握PHP、Java和C++,成为全栈开发高手
在当今这个快速发展的互联网时代,编程语言的应用已经渗透到了各个领域,作为一名有抱负的程序员,掌握多种编程语言将使你在职场中更具竞争力,本文将为你介绍PHP、Java和C++这三种流行的编程语言,帮助你成为一名全栈开发高手。
1、PHP简介
PHP是一种开源的通用脚本语言,主要用于Web开发,它的语法简洁易懂,学习成本较低,PHP可以与HTML结合使用,生成动态网页内容,PHP还可以嵌入到HTML中,与HTML代码混合编写,实现更高效的开发,PHP支持多种数据库系统,如MySQL、Oracle等,可以方便地进行数据处理和存储。
2、Java简介
Java是一种面向对象的编程语言,具有跨平台、安全性高等特点,Java广泛应用于企业级应用开发、桌面应用开发以及Android应用开发等领域,Java具有良好的可扩展性和可维护性,使得开发者能够更容易地进行项目的开发和维护,Java还拥有丰富的类库和框架,如Spring、Hibernate等,可以帮助开发者快速构建功能强大的应用程序。
3、C++简介
C++是一种通用的编程语言,以其高性能、灵活性和可移植性而著称,C++可以用于开发各种类型的应用程序,如操作系统、游戏、嵌入式系统等,C++支持面向对象编程、泛型编程等编程范式,使得开发者能够根据项目需求选择合适的编程风格,C++还拥有丰富的类库和工具链,如STL、Boost等,可以帮助开发者提高开发效率。
4、全栈开发概述
全栈开发者是指具备前端、后端和数据库等多方面技能的开发者,他们可以独立完成一个项目的整个开发过程,从需求分析、设计、编码到测试和部署等环节,全栈开发者通常需要熟悉多种编程语言和技术栈,以便能够灵活地应对不同的项目需求。
5、学习路径建议
如果你想成为一名全栈开发高手,以下是一些建议的学习路径:
1、学习基本的计算机科学知识,如数据结构、算法、操作系统等;
2、学习HTML、CSS和JavaScript等前端技术,掌握网页制作的基本技能;
3、学习PHP或Java的基础知识,了解其语法特点和常用功能;
4、学习数据库技术,如SQL、NoSQL等,掌握如何使用数据库进行数据处理和存储;
5、学习版本控制工具Git,掌握团队协作开发的技巧;
6、学习一种或多种全栈框架,如Spring Boot、Django等,提高开发效率;
7、实践项目经验,不断积累实战经验。
6、总结
掌握PHP、Java和C++这三种编程语言将使你在全栈开发领域具有很大的竞争优势,通过学习这些编程语言和技术栈,你可以更好地满足不同类型项目的需求,为自己的职业生涯发展奠定坚实的基础,希望本文能为你提供一些有用的建议和指导,祝你早日成为一名优秀的全栈开发高手!
还没有评论,来说两句吧...